Position: Virtual Education Ambassador
Time Commitment Options
- Minimum: 5 hours per week
- Recommended: 10-15 hours per week
- Maximum: Flexible based on your availability
- Duration: 3-6 months (renewable)
Responsibilities (Choose Your Focus)
Educational Outreach
- Connect with teachers via email and virtual platforms
- Create digital content for classroom use
- Support online student workshops
- Help organize virtual events
- Assist with competition coordination
Digital Marketing
- Create social media content
- Design educational graphics
- Write blog posts and newsletters
- Support email campaigns
- Develop online engagement strategies
Program Support
- Assist with virtual workshop coordination
- Help manage online submissions
- Provide technical support to participants
- Create resource guides
- Translate materials (if multilingual)
